Thatching is the procedure of eliminating the layer of dead grass, roots, and organic debris that collects in between the soil and living lawn, which can hamper water, air, and nutrient absorption. Extreme thatch can cause shallow root systems, increased pest problems, and unequal development. Strategies for thatching include manual raking or the use of specialized dethatching equipment that lifts and eliminates the layer without harmful healthy turf The procedure is often followed by aeration, overseeding, or fertilization to promote healthy healing and development. Regular thatching makes sure much better soil-to-grass contact, boosts nutrient uptake, and preserves a rich, resilient lawn. Including thatching into yard care routines improves both the appearance and long-term health of turf.
